A golf association requires that golf balls have a diameter that is
1.68inches. To determine if golf balls conform to the standard, a random sample of golf balls was selected. Their diameters are shown in the accompanying data table. Do the golf balls conform to the standards? Use the alphaαequals=0.01 level of significance.
Diameter_(in.) |
1.683 |
1.686 |
1.684 |
1.685 |
1.677 |
1.677 |
1.684 |
1.682 |
1.682 |
1.685 |
1.673 |
1.674 |
Find the Test Statistic
Find the P-Value
